Re: Window Motor locking up

We had this problem on our 2010 robot, using window motors to rotate the swerve modules (1 window motor for two wheels).

We found the issue was the thermal break, and the motors would stop until they cooled down.

Try to find ways to reduce the friction in the system, or add some other assists to reduce the work load on the motors. Also, be sure they are well ventilated, and maybe even add some cooling (fans) to help.

My understanding is that the thermal break is a safety feature - these are really window motors, and if part of someone was caught in the window as it was being rolled up, this thermal break would cause the motor to stop to avoid a worse injury.
